I come to the Garden of Gethsemane this morning weary. I don’t think I can stay awake one minute much less one hour. Failure weighs heavy on my heart. I worked so hard to write, but am I good enough?
My garden of words are fertilized, pruned, and plucked. Will they grow and flourish and touch?
I desire with all my heart to write for you, Jesus. I pray you will use me to deliver your words with precision. To reach others to share the gift of eternity. I don’t want them to miss you because I left a comma off and they are lost in the message and noise.
God touch them, please. My sisters who are also striving to reach you, to serve you. We are all here in your garden, knowing we will fall short. But you Jesus will pick up our failures, our weaknesses, and our fears and will replace them with your flowers of beauty and your grace.
